Pharming Group N.V. (PHAR) delivered a concise presentation at the Jefferies London Healthcare Conference 2025, using a slideshow to update investors on company strategy, clinical progress and near-term objectives. Management framed the session around three core themes: pipeline advancement, commercial execution and financial discipline. The slides highlighted recent clinical milestones, program timelines and the company’s plans to prioritize resources toward high-value development and commercialization opportunities.

Commercial performance and market access were described as central to Pharming’s growth pathway. The presentation reviewed recent sales trends, geographic expansion efforts and key initiatives intended to strengthen uptake and reimbursement for marketed assets. Management signaled continued focus on expanding distribution channels and supporting treating physicians through targeted medical affairs and payer engagement.

On the development side, the company summarized progress across its clinical portfolio, noting upcoming readouts and regulatory interactions that could drive near-term value. The slides outlined expected milestones and a high-level risk/reward profile for each program, while emphasizing data-driven decision-making to allocate capital efficiently.

Financial commentary stressed balance-sheet management and capital allocation aimed at sustaining development programs without compromising commercial momentum. Management reiterated priorities for cash deployment, potential non-dilutive financing options and measures to manage operational costs.

The presentation concluded with a Q&A that provided additional context on clinical timelines, partner collaborations and the company’s strategy to create shareholder value. Management emphasized readiness to adjust plans based on trial data and market dynamics, underscoring a pragmatic approach to execution.

Slides from the presentation were made available during or shortly after the conference, giving investors the opportunity to review the materials in detail. Overall, Pharming’s Jefferies presentation aimed to reassure investors by combining operational updates with a clear set of near-term catalysts and a disciplined financial framework.
